BLASCO NAVARRO, Marilin et al. Pathological characterization of dead neonates during 2010-2014. MEDISAN [online]. 2017, vol.21, n.6, pp. 672-680. ISSN 1029-3019.

A cross-sectional and retrospective study of the 55 neonates undergoing autopsy was carried out in the Pathology Department of "Dr. Juan Bruno Zayas Alfonso" General Hospital in Santiago de Cuba, during 2010-2014, to identify the pathological characteristics that allowed to determine the causes of deaths and to describe the maternal and neonatal concurrent factors in the latter. Among the main findings the prevalence of these deaths in 2010 was significant, with 16; from male sex (61.81 %); 32 with neonatal early death, of preterm birth with low birth weight (94.44 %), of Caesarean delivery and of pre-eclampsia as maternal history. The most frequent basic cause of death was being born before term with low weight in 30 neonates; and the direct cause of death, hypoxia in 15 of them

Keywords : pregnant woman; newborn; ponderal deficiency; neonatal death; infant mortality; autopsy; pathology; maternal hospital.
